Arrow To Brabus and all...

Just to clarify my position here, what I am referring to is what I think is the best engine tuner around. Endyn, to me, is the best tuner, because of the work they do in taking an already high quality engine design, and improving it to make them more powerful and efficient (think 23:1 static compression ratio). And the fact that they don't rely on conventional displacement-favoring engineering approaches to ameliorate their engines helps solidify them as the greatest tuner of all time in my book.
